What Makes Capybaras the Perfect Cartoon Stars?

Key Insights

Capybaras—native to South America—are naturally endearing creatures. With their large, soft bodies, curious expressions, and calm, friendly demeanor, they embody the ideal combination of cuteness and approachability. These traits translate effortlessly into animation, where exaggerated smiles, expressive eyes, and gentle movements enhance emotional connection.

1. Universal Appeal and Relatable Behavior
Capybara cartoons often exaggerate their natural calm and social behavior, portraying them as gentle, pacifist, and deeply sociable animals. This relatability lifts them beyond wildlife documentaries and into comedic or heartwarming stories that appeal universally—from families and kids to anime and cartoon enthusiasts across cultures.

2. Online Virality and Short-Form Success
Short animated clips featuring capybaras have taken social media by storm. Platforms like TikTok, Instagram Reels, and YouTube Shorts thrive on visually compelling, easy-to-digest content, and capybara cartoons deliver exactly that. Their quiet antics, quirky reactions, and synchronized group humor make for perfect 15- to 60-second stories that capture attention rapidly.

3. Style and Atmosphere
Capybara cartoons often blend realistic Southern South American environments with whimsical, stylized animation. Whether set in lush jungles, serene wetlands, or futuristic lowlands, the warm, muted color palettes and soft lighting contribute to a peaceful, inviting vibe. This aesthetic supports mindfulness and emotional comfort—qualities increasingly sought after in today’s fast-paced digital world.
